How dehumidifiers tackle damp in Little Shelford

The idea is simple: the unit draws in damp air, the moisture condenses and collects in a tank (or drains away), and drier air is pushed back into the room. For a cellar or cold room in Little Shelford, you'll want a model suited to cool spaces and matched to the volume you're drying.

How quickly will it dry my room?

Most rooms feel noticeably less damp within 2 to 3 days; a soaked cellar or fresh plaster in Little Shelford can take a little longer. We'll suggest a sensible hire length when you ask.

Can it help with mould on the walls?

Yes, indirectly — mould thrives on damp air. Keep things dry and you break the cycle. For heavy growth, treat the surface first, then dry the room.
